Chapter 1 Why Arduino open source platform, the key is open source, that the spirit of creation

Why Arduino open source platform, the key is open source, that the spirit of creation

 

I like the open-source word, this is a wonderful concept that does not mean we do not support copyright law. Intellectual property rights must be protected, which is the fundamental guarantee for scientific and technological progress. Because of this protection, just let some genius ideas become a reality, and promote the development of civilization. This does not conflict with the open source, we need creativity! But creativity is nurtured, foster creativity in this stage, we need to open this idea!

Arduino open source platform is a good example!

First of all, so it is easy to design open source!

 

How to open hardware platform, Arduino select the Creative Commons license to ensure that no one is allowed to produce copies of the circuit board, but also to re-design, sales and even a replica of the original design.

The greatest advantage is the construction of the ecological environment! Free and Open Source!

 

 

I would like to describe its work processes, work is based on hardware: a programmable circuit board (called microcontroller); software Arduino IDE (Integrated Development Environment), we can write code on a computer, and then write computer code and uploaded into the physical plate.

Arduino programming provides a good platform Powerise, before learning that knowledge must understand the following points.

What Arduino board do?

Reads various sensor signals processed output, control motors and other equipment, control your dreams.

First, what can you do?

Use the Arduino IDE software distribution control commands to the microcontroller! Realize your ideas.

third,

Third, the biggest advantage is the convenience Arduino, you only need a computer, a USB cable.

Fourth, programming the low starting point, Arduino IDE using a simplified version of C ++, the fixed and simple form.

 

Many different types of Arduino board, the key is the use of different microcontrollers, but they have in common is programmed using the Arduino IDE.

 

On the difference in function, like we grasp the following points:

1, the number of different Arduino board input and output.

2, showing the speed difference, difference in dimensions

3, the operating voltage difference needed, 3.7V or 5V.

4, embedded board no programming interface (hardware), must be purchased separately.

 Arduino Uno is based ATmega328P microcontroller development board.

 

Guess you like

Origin www.cnblogs.com/ztg1/p/12554610.html